Anterior humeral circumflex artery

Definition

An artery that branches from the axilliary artery and supplies the deltoid, biceps brachii, and coracobrachialis muscles, the glenohumeral joint, the proximal humeral head, and the skin overlying the anterior aspect of the proximal humerus. This artery courses laterally across the anterior surface of the humerus and anastomoses with the posterior humeral circumflex artery.
